Megan Mullally

Megan Mullally, born November 12, 1958 in Los Angeles California United States is among the wealthiest and most well-known TV Actress. She was one of the regulars on the Adult Swim's Children's Hospital program with MalinAkerman. Megan Mullally, born November 12th 1958 is an American actor comedian and a singer. She portrayed Karen Walker on the NBC sitcom Will & Grace (1998-2006, 2017-2020) where she earned eight Primetime Emmy Award nominations for Outstanding Supporting actor in the category of Comedy Series winning twice in 2001 and in 2006. The actress was also nominated in numerous areas for her performances, including the Screen Actors Guild Awards seven times for Outstanding Acting by a Woman in an Comedy Series. One of her first acting spots was on a McDonald's commercial that also was a part of John Goodman. She debuted in The Ellen Burstyn Show, a series that aired in 1986. Later on, she guest-starred in comedy shows such as Frasier and Seinfeld. Ned and Stacey Mad About You Caroline and City 3rd Rock from the Sun. She played the lead character of the Murder She Wrote episode called Coal Miner's Slaughter. Following that, she got married in 2003 to Nick Offerman. In 2015, she played the character of Grandma Linda in Hotel Transylvania 2. Mullally was the child in Los Angeles the California home of Martha Mullally-Jr. and Carter Mullally Jr. a Paramount Pictures contract actor from the 1950s. Mullally moved back in Oklahoma City when she was only six years old. She's English Irish with Scandinavian roots. She began ballet at her age of 6 and performed at the Oklahoma City Ballet during high school. She also attended the School of American Ballet in New York City.
